Daniel Kutscher has authored 13 papers that have received a total of 376 indexed citations.
This includes 8 papers in Analytical Chemistry, 5 papers in Spectroscopy and 3 papers in Health, Toxicology and Mutagenesis. The topics of these papers are Analytical chemistry methods development (7 papers), Mass Spectrometry Techniques and Applications (5 papers) and Advanced Proteomics Techniques and Applications (3 papers). Daniel Kutscher is often cited by papers focused on Analytical chemistry methods development (7 papers), Mass Spectrometry Techniques and Applications (5 papers) and Advanced Proteomics Techniques and Applications (3 papers) and collaborates with scholars based in Spain, Germany and United States. Daniel Kutscher's co-authors include Jörg Bettmer, Alfredo Sanz‐Medel, María Montes‐Bayón, Detlef Günther and Wilhelm Schänzer and has published in prestigious journals such as Analytical Chemistry, Analytica Chimica Acta and Talanta.
